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Gunnersbury to Ancaster start from as little as £19.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Gunnersbury to Ancaster start from £40.10 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Gunnersbury to Ancaster are available for £92.60 one way

Station Facilities and Accessibility

While Gunnersbury Station exudes charm and practical convenience, it does have its limitations in terms of facilities. Traditional ticket offices are absent, yet there are accessible ticket machines available for a smooth ticket purchasing process, particularly handy for online collection. The station embraces inclusivity, with induction loops installed, assisting passengers with hearing impairments.

Although the station lacks step-free access for entry and exit, it supports step-free interchange between the District Line and London Overground trains. This interchange capability broadens accessibility throughout the network. Furthermore, passengers in need of assistance can pre-book this up to two hours before commencing their journey, creating a seamless travel experience.

Transport Connections to Explore the City

Gunnersbury Station enjoys robust transport links. Bus services are well-connected, seamlessly integrating with TfL's city network, which can be explored in detail via their interactive map. Should there be a service disruption, replacement buses conveniently stop on Chiswick High Road, right outside the station.

For those needing to travel further afield, interchange options at Hammersmith pave the way to Heathrow Airport, courtesy of the Piccadilly Line. Whether you're heading to Willesden Junction or the cultural hub of Camden Road, the station's connectivity caters to every urban traveler’s needs.

Facilities and Amenities at Ancaster Station

Ancaster Station, while modest, is adequately equipped to cater to the essential needs of passengers. It should be noted that there is no ticket office or ticket machines available at the station. Therefore, it’s advisable for travelers to purchase their tickets online or through other means ahead of time. Smartcard users will be pleased to find validators at the station.

In terms of facilities for those needing assistance, there are customer help points located within the station. Step-free access is partial with Platform 1 fully accessible, though Platform 2 involves navigating a barrow crossing with uneven surfaces. It’s a Category B station, indicating that access is possible with some difficulty. The station lacks toilet facilities, waiting rooms, and seating areas, but help point services can be approached for any assistance.

Onward Travel Options

Traveling onward from Ancaster Station is straightforward with various options. Though direct bus services aren't specified, there's a rail replacement service available on the main road adjacent to the Station Approach Road. Taxis can be an accessible option with several local companies ready for hire including Grantham Station Taxi, Target, and Tiger taxis.
